What is the 4-7-8 Method?
The 4-7-8 breathing technique, also known as the Relaxing Breath, is a method developed by Dr. Andrew Weil that involves a specific breathing pattern to promote relaxation and reduce stress. It's easy to learn and can be done anywhere, making it a convenient tool for managing anxiety or improving sleep quality.
How to Practice the 4-7-8 Method:
- Find a comfortable position: Sit or lie down in a quiet place where you can focus on your breath.
- Exhale completely: Empty your lungs of air through your mouth with a whooshing sound.
- Inhale quietly through your nose for 4 seconds: Take a deep breath in, counting to four slowly.
- Hold your breath for 7 seconds: Pause and hold your breath for a count of seven.
- Exhale forcefully through your mouth for 8 seconds: Release your breath audibly in eight seconds.
- Repeat the cycle: Perform the 4-7-8 breathing pattern for a minimum of four breath cycles or as needed.
Benefits of the 4-7-8 Method:
- Reduces anxiety and stress levels
- Promotes relaxation and calmness
- Improves sleep quality
- Enhances focus and concentration
- Aids in managing anger and cravings
